Vulnerability Details : CVE-2021-34235
Potential exploit
Tokheim Profleet DiaLOG 11.005.02 is affected by SQL Injection. The component is the Field__UserLogin parameter on the logon page.
Vulnerability category: Sql Injection

CWE ids for CVE-2021-34235
-
The product constructs all or part of an SQL command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ended SQL command when it is sent to a downstream component. Without sufficient removal or quoting of SQL syntax in user-controllable inputs, the generated SQL query can cause those inputs to be interpreted as SQL instead of ordinary user data.Assigned by: nvd@nist.gov (Primary)
